ERA 300- What size is the screw that is used for mounting the speaker to a fixed object?  Thanks all

The size of the screws doesn’t seem to be mentioned anywhere, but the Era 300 guide mentions drilling 9/64” (3.5mm) holes for the wall-mount’s screws.

Below is a screenshot of the installation instructions for the Sanus speaker stand for Era 300.  They use an M5 screw, but the length will obviously depend on your particular application.

Well, the Sonos stand and wall mount documentation only refers to the them as ‘short screws’…

Note that the bottom of the Era 300s are not flat, so if you’re using a custom bottom plate it either needs to be a rod like the Sonos stand, covered at the correct angle like the Sonos wall mount, or set on the two ‘feet’ at the bottom of the speaker, which is probably around 7 inches apart (depth) given the speaker dimensions.  And of course, with a flat surface, you’ll need longer screws.
